Huss blog

Share this post

Cómo resumir conversaciones de grupos de Whatsapp con OpenAI

huss.substack.com

Cómo resumir conversaciones de grupos de Whatsapp con OpenAI

De más de 10 grupos sin leer en Whatsapp a 50 palabras en resumen

Hussam Sufan
Feb 17
7
Share this post

Cómo resumir conversaciones de grupos de Whatsapp con OpenAI

huss.substack.com

Disclaimer: lo que verás ahora será una base educativa para algunos de los siguientes post que armaremos en este espacio.

Si el título te pareció clickbait, puede que sí pero es real. Hace poco (no sé cómo pasó la verdad…) me metí en muchos grupos de Whatsapp y además creamos una comunidad de apoyo entre Startups e Inversionistas entre amigos llamada The Startups Group por si quieres entrar (son más de 1.000 personas, advierto) sumado a los grupos que ya tienes con la familia, amigos, etc. En un momento, mi cerebro hizo crash 🤯 y dije esto no es sostenible…

Otro ejemplo: te vas de vacaciones 🌴 te quieres desconectar 1 semana del celular, abres whatsapp y uffff! no le deseo a nadie esa misión (mejor poner a todos leídos haha) pero si eres de las personas que tienen FOMO, acá te quiero compartir una solución que pude armar el fin de semana usando la API de OpenAI.

Antes de que sigas leyendo, y aún no estás suscrit@ te invito a que lo hagas. Hablaremos temas sobre: growth, marketing, producto, AI y management. Temas que me encantan y seguro que si estás acá, alguno de ellos compartiremos 🤩

Sigamos… te adelanto que si entiendes este post, te servirá de base para el siguiente que viene sobre cómo automatizar creaciones de contenido, potenciando tu SEO y tráfico orgánico. Así que, mucha atención y ojos 👀 porque si quieres acortar los tiempos de ciertos procesos, esta entretenida base que veremos hoy te va a servir para crear grandes cosas mañana.

¿Qué necesitas?

  1. Buena disposición

  2. Nociones básicas de programación

  3. Elegir un chat grupal de Whatsapp que quieras resumir

Contexto

Aclaro que esto no puedes hacerlo directo desde ChatGPT porque tendrás la limitante de tokens y palabras (no te preocupes ahora de entender eso, pero existe un límite si lo haces directo) mientras que hacerlo por la API también lo tienes pero existen maneras de hacer un bypass.

Paso a paso

  1. Exporta el chat de Whatsapp que quieras resumir. Cuento con la autorización de Sebastián Araos y Rodrigo Rojo para exponer públicamente sus stickers y memes 🐶 Y gracias Alec Dickinson por hacerme tan consciente del GDPR de cara a la privacidad de los datos 🙂

    Paso a paso para exportar un grupo de Whatsapp a tu compu

  2. Harás una copia en tu Google Drive del siguiente script hecho en Python, para que puedas manipularlo y tu gusto. *Aclaro que vamos a trabajar a nivel de código porque solo nos interesa que funcione, por ahora. Si alguien se anima a crear la interfaz gráfica, bienvenido sea!

    1. Abre el siguiente archivo creado en Google Colab ¿qué es esto? báscicamente, un entorno de programación online. Puedes usar otras opciones locales pero por ahora te recomiendo este.

    2. Click en “Archivo” y después “Guardar una copia en Drive”

    3. Dentro del archivo, busca la sección donde dice “API de OpenAI” para que puedas ingresar la tuya (it’s free) Sin esto, no funcionará. ¿Dónde encontrarla?

      1. Haces Login en: https://openai.com/api/

      2. Serás redirigido a: https://platform.openai.com/overview

      3. Arriba a la derecha verás tu fotito de perfil (o no) haces click ahí y luego en: View API keys

      4. Una vez dentro, click en “Create new secret key” y eso papiro de texto lo copias y lo pegas en el archivo que hiciste la copia en la parte correspondiente. Es único para cada persona.

      5. Finalmente, dentro del archivo de Google Colab haz click en la carpeta del menú izquierdo para ir viendo el proceso en tiempo real. Una vez tenga todo lo anterior hecho, haz click en “Play” en el primer bloque de código. Una vez que termine, dale play con el segundo bloque y baja hasta el final del archivo donde te pedirá que subas el archivo a resumir .txt. Si todo sale bien, al final del proceso verás “summaries.txt” que es donde verás tu archivo procesado con el resumen (igual lo irás viendo a medida que se procesa en Google Colab) como en la siguiente imagen:

        Luego de iniciar el segundo bloque de código, la plataforma al final te pedirá subir tu archivo .txt de la conversación.

  3. ¡Y listo! Ya tienes resumidas tus conversaciones de grupos infinitos en 50 palabras. Puedes abrir directo el archivo “summaries.txt” o descargarlo. Algunos recordatorios y alcances importantes antes de cerrar:

    1. ¿Puedes procesar otro tipo de archivo? Sí, pero tendrás que codificarlos/decoficiarlos según corresponda.

    2. ¿De qué me sirve aprender esto? De mucho:

      1. Ya sabes usar la API de OpenAI (practica, practica y practica)

      2. Te diste cuenta que puedes entender un programa en Python (o al menos, nociones básicas. Sana incomodidad)

      3. Tienes una base para crear otros programas similares para la necesidad que tengas. Y por qué no, puede ser tu próxima startup.

¿Tienes algún comentario, crítica constructiva, sugerencia, idea, otro? Déjala en los comentarios o respóndeme este correo si te llego por mail, para que construyamos en conjunto 🤝

Se vienen hartas cosas que iré comparetiendo con foco más de negocio. Esta primera pincelada, era para mostrarte algo entretenido y, al mismo tiempo el potencial que tiene para ir preparando la cancha 🚀

C’ya!

Comparte el artículo por Whatsapp

Share this post

Cómo resumir conversaciones de grupos de Whatsapp con OpenAI

huss.substack.com
Comments
TopNewCommunity

No posts

Ready for more?

© 2023 Hussam Sufan
Privacy ∙ Terms ∙ Collection notice
Start WritingGet the app
Substack is the home for great writing